Provider
(1) The person that oversees the patient’s health care; often a physician, physician’s assistant, or nurse practitioner. (2) An individual licensed to examine, diagnose, and prescribe treatment to patients seeking assistance.
Wheal
A raised, itchy area of skin that usually signifies an allergic reaction.
Injection Site
The specific area of the body where a needle is inserted to deliver medication or vaccines.
Decline Stage
Becoming less intense, subsiding; a period of time when the symptoms of disease start to disappear.
